Understanding Handheld Ultrasound Technology
Handheld ultrasound devices represent a leap forward in diagnostic imaging. These compact tools offer portability, ease of use, and affordable pricing compared to traditional ultrasound machines. This technology enables clinicians to perform quick assessments at the point of care, ensuring timely and effective treatment decisions.
In primary care settings, handheld ultrasound devices are becoming essential tools for physicians. They enable doctors to swiftly evaluate patients with abdominal pain, suspected fractures, or cardiovascular issues without sending them to imaging centers. This immediate access to ultrasound imaging saves time, reduces patient anxiety, and ultimately enhances the quality of care.
Impact on Emergency Medicine
The integration of handheld ultrasound in emergency medicine cannot be overstated. Emergency departments face the challenge of high patient volumes and the need for rapid decision-making. Handheld ultrasound solutions empower emergency physicians to conduct bedside assessments, guiding life-saving interventions. For example, detecting free fluid in trauma cases or assessing cardiac function can be accomplished more efficiently with these portable devices.
Benefits in Rural and Underserved Areas
The advent of handheld ultrasound technology is particularly beneficial for rural and underserved communities. Access to conventional imaging services in these areas can be limited, leading to delays in diagnosis and treatment. Handheld ultrasound devices bridge this gap by providing healthcare workers with the capability to perform ultrasounds in remote settings. This innovation increases the reach of diagnostic services, improving overall healthcare outcomes.

Clinical Applications of Handheld Ultrasound
The versatility of handheld ultrasound is evident in its various clinical applications. In obstetrics, practitioners can use these devices for quick fetal assessments, improving prenatal care. In sports medicine, they can assist in diagnosing musculoskeletal injuries, allowing for immediate treatment options.
Moreover, the devices work well in telemedicine settings, where remote consultations have become increasingly popular. Physicians can use handheld ultrasound to transmit real-time imaging data to specialists, facilitating collaborative diagnoses without the need for physical travel.
Future Prospects
As technology continues to evolve, the capabilities of handheld ultrasound are expected to expand. Advances in image quality, battery life, and connectivity could enhance its functionality further, making it an indispensable tool across multiple healthcare sectors.
